2. What does "Fully Hallmarked" signify for this 2H925-482?
A full hallmark is a series of marks struck by a UK Assay Office. It confirms that the metal has been independently tested to meet the 925 sterling silver standard. This provides legal protection and guaranteed purity that a simple "925" stamp cannot offer alone.
3. Does 9.0mm width affect the flexibility of the silver?
The 9.0mm width is substantial, but because the chain consists of individual interlocking links, it maintains high fluidic flexibility. This allows the 63g weight to drape naturally around the neck without the stiffness often associated with rigid torque necklaces.
4. Why is copper added to this 925 silver alloy?
Pure silver (99.9%) is too soft for a heavy 63g chain and would stretch or scratch instantly. The addition of 7.5% copper creates the Sterling standard, significantly increasing the Vickers hardness to ensure the links can withstand decades of mechanical friction.

Maritime Environment & Restoration
9. Does Devon’s salt air cause permanent damage to silver?
Salt air causes "Surface Chloride Tarnish," which appears as a dull grey or black film. On a 63g solid chain, this is purely aesthetic and can be removed. It only becomes "permanent" on thin plated items where the silver layer is worn away.
10. What is "Ultrasonic Cleaning" for vintage silver?
We use high-frequency sound waves in a chemical solution to implode bubbles against the silver. This removes 20+ years of organic buildup from the inside of the link pivots, which a standard cloth cannot reach, ensuring the chain moves freely.
11. Can I use silver "dip" solutions on this heavy chain?
We advise against prolonged use of chemical dips. They can leave the silver "thirsty" and prone to faster re-tarnishing. A dual-impregnated polishing cloth is the technically superior method for maintaining a 63g solid piece.
12. Why does the 2.6mm depth matter for cleaning?
The 2.6mm depth indicates thick link walls. This allows for deep mechanical polishing to remove deeper scratches without compromising the structural wall of the link—a luxury not available with modern lightweight imports.
